परिचय
दोष सहिष्णुता आधुनिक कंप्यूटर सिस्टम और नेटवर्क का एक महत्वपूर्ण पहलू है जो विफलताओं की उपस्थिति में भी सेवाओं और अनुप्रयोगों के निर्बाध संचालन को सुनिश्चित करता है। OneProxy (oneproxy.pro) जैसे प्रॉक्सी सर्वर प्रदाता के लिए, गलती सहनशीलता अत्यंत महत्वपूर्ण है क्योंकि यह सीधे उनकी सेवाओं की विश्वसनीयता और उपलब्धता को प्रभावित करती है। यह लेख दोष सहनशीलता की अवधारणा, इसके इतिहास, आंतरिक संरचना, मुख्य विशेषताएं, प्रकार, कार्यान्वयन के तरीके, चुनौतियां और भविष्य के दृष्टिकोण के साथ-साथ प्रॉक्सी सर्वर के साथ इसके संबंध की पड़ताल करता है।
दोष सहनशीलता की उत्पत्ति और पहला उल्लेख
गलती सहनशीलता की अवधारणा 20वीं सदी के मध्य में इंजीनियरिंग और कंप्यूटर विज्ञान के क्षेत्र से उभरी। प्रारंभ में, इसे मुख्य रूप से एयरोस्पेस सिस्टम और सैन्य हार्डवेयर में लागू किया गया था, जहां विफलताओं के विनाशकारी परिणाम हो सकते थे। शब्द "फॉल्ट टॉलरेंस" पहली बार 1950 में रिचर्ड हैमिंग द्वारा "एरर डिटेक्टिंग एंड एर करेक्टिंग कोड्स" शीर्षक वाले पेपर में पेश किया गया था, जिन्होंने कंप्यूटिंग सिस्टम में त्रुटि-सुधार कोड को गलती सहनशीलता के साधन के रूप में वर्णित किया था।
दोष सहनशीलता के बारे में विस्तृत जानकारी
दोष सहनशीलता किसी सिस्टम या नेटवर्क की घटक विफलताओं या अप्रत्याशित स्थितियों की स्थिति में सही ढंग से कार्य करना जारी रखने की क्षमता है। इसमें समग्र प्रदर्शन पर विफलताओं के प्रभाव को कम करने के लिए सिस्टम आर्किटेक्चर में अतिरेक और लचीलेपन को डिजाइन करना शामिल है। दोष सहनशीलता का प्राथमिक लक्ष्य प्रतिकूल घटनाओं की स्थिति में भी सिस्टम की उपलब्धता, विश्वसनीयता और डेटा अखंडता को बनाए रखना है।
दोष सहनशीलता की आंतरिक संरचना
दोष सहनशीलता हार्डवेयर और सॉफ्टवेयर तंत्र के संयोजन के माध्यम से प्राप्त की जाती है। दोष सहनशीलता की आंतरिक संरचना में अनावश्यक घटक, त्रुटि का पता लगाने और सुधार के तरीके और विफलता तंत्र शामिल हैं। सिस्टम का डिज़ाइन यह सुनिश्चित करता है कि यदि एक घटक विफल हो जाता है, तो दूसरा निर्बाध रूप से काम संभाल लेता है, जिससे सेवा में कोई व्यवधान नहीं आता है।
दोष सहनशीलता की प्रमुख विशेषताओं का विश्लेषण
दोष सहनशीलता की प्रमुख विशेषताओं में शामिल हैं:
-
फालतूपन: दोष-सहिष्णु प्रणालियों में अनावश्यक घटक शामिल होते हैं जो विफलता होने पर काम संभाल सकते हैं। यह अतिरेक विफलता के एकल बिंदुओं को कम करता है और सिस्टम की विश्वसनीयता बढ़ाता है।
-
त्रुटि का पता लगाना और सुधार करना: डेटा ट्रांसमिशन या स्टोरेज में त्रुटियों का पता लगाने और उन्हें ठीक करने के लिए चेकसम, त्रुटि-सुधार कोड और समता जांच जैसे तंत्र कार्यरत हैं।
-
फेलओवर और लोड बैलेंसिंग: विफलता की स्थिति में, एक दोष-सहिष्णु प्रणाली स्वचालित रूप से बैकअप घटकों पर स्विच कर सकती है या लोड संतुलन का उपयोग करके उपलब्ध संसाधनों में कार्यभार वितरित कर सकती है।
-
त्रुटि का पृथक्करण: दोष-सहिष्णु प्रणालियाँ दोषपूर्ण घटक को शेष प्रणाली को प्रभावित करने से रोकने के लिए उसे अलग कर सकती हैं।
-
निगरानी और पुनर्प्राप्ति: सिस्टम स्वास्थ्य की निरंतर निगरानी से दोषों का शीघ्र पता लगाने और तत्काल पुनर्प्राप्ति कार्रवाई की अनुमति मिलती है।
दोष सहनशीलता के प्रकार
प्रकार | विवरण |
---|---|
हार्डवेयर अतिरेक | इस प्रकार में बिजली आपूर्ति या हार्ड ड्राइव जैसे महत्वपूर्ण हार्डवेयर घटकों की नकल करना शामिल है, ताकि यह सुनिश्चित किया जा सके कि प्राथमिक घटक विफल होने पर बैकअप उपलब्ध है। |
सॉफ़्टवेयर अतिरेक | इसमें विभिन्न सर्वरों पर अनावश्यक सॉफ़्टवेयर इंस्टेंस चलाना शामिल है, इसलिए यदि कोई विफल हो जाता है, तो दूसरा बिना किसी रुकावट के कार्यभार संभाल सकता है। |
सूचना अतिरेक | इसमें कई भंडारण स्थानों पर महत्वपूर्ण डेटा की नकल करना या भंडारण विफलताओं के मामले में डेटा अखंडता बनाए रखने के लिए डेटा मिररिंग तकनीकों का उपयोग करना शामिल है। |
समय अतिरेक | इसमें एक ही गणना को कई बार करना और सटीकता सुनिश्चित करने के लिए परिणामों की तुलना करना शामिल है। |
विविधता अतिरेक | एक ही कारण से होने वाली एकाधिक विफलताओं की संभावना को कम करने के लिए विविध हार्डवेयर और सॉफ़्टवेयर घटकों का उपयोग करता है। |
दोष सहनशीलता और संबंधित चुनौतियों का उपयोग करने के तरीके
महत्वपूर्ण प्रणालियों की विश्वसनीयता सुनिश्चित करने के लिए विभिन्न डोमेन में दोष सहिष्णुता लागू की जाती है। कुछ सामान्य अनुप्रयोगों में शामिल हैं:
-
डेटा केंद्र: सर्वर और नेटवर्क उपकरण के निरंतर संचालन को बनाए रखने के लिए डेटा केंद्रों में दोष सहिष्णुता महत्वपूर्ण है।
-
वितरित प्रणाली: दोष सहनशीलता वितरित प्रणालियों में नोड्स के बीच विश्वसनीय संचार और समन्वय को सक्षम बनाती है।
-
दूरसंचार: दूरसंचार नेटवर्क में दोष सहनशीलता निर्बाध संचार सेवाएं सुनिश्चित करती है।
-
नाजूक आधारभूत श्रंचना: व्यापक विफलताओं को रोकने के लिए पावर ग्रिड, परिवहन प्रणालियों और अन्य महत्वपूर्ण बुनियादी ढांचे में दोष सहिष्णुता लागू की जाती है।
-
क्लाउड कम्प्यूटिंग: क्लाउड सेवा प्रदाता अपने ग्राहकों के लिए सेवा उपलब्धता बनाए रखने के लिए दोष सहनशीलता लागू करते हैं।
दोष सहनशीलता से संबंधित चुनौतियों में शामिल हैं:
- बढ़ी हुई विश्वसनीयता के लाभों के साथ अतिरेक की लागत को संतुलित करना।
- संभावित विफलताओं को घटित होने से पहले ही पहचानना और उनका पूर्वानुमान लगाना।
- अनावश्यक घटकों को कुशलतापूर्वक प्रबंधित और सिंक्रनाइज़ करना।
- जटिल प्रणालियों में विफलता के एकल बिंदुओं से बचना।
- रुक-रुक कर होने वाले क्षणिक दोषों से निपटना।
मुख्य विशेषताएँ और समान शब्दों के साथ तुलना
विशेषता | उच्च उपलब्धता के साथ तुलना | आपदा पुनर्प्राप्ति के साथ तुलना |
---|---|---|
उद्देश्य | विफलताओं के दौरान निरंतर संचालन सुनिश्चित करना। | किसी बड़े सेवा व्यवधान के बाद उबरने के लिए। |
केंद्र | घटक विफलताओं के दौरान डाउनटाइम को रोकना। | एक भयावह घटना के बाद पुनर्प्राप्ति और बहाली। |
समयमान | मिलीसेकंड से मिनट तक. | घंटों से दिन तक. |
दायरा | किसी एकल सिस्टम या एप्लिकेशन में स्थानीयकृत। | आमतौर पर इसमें संपूर्ण डेटा केंद्र या क्षेत्र शामिल होता है। |
डेटा प्रतिकृति | अक्सर अतिरेक के लिए डेटा प्रतिकृति शामिल होती है। | आमतौर पर इसमें डेटा बैकअप और पुनर्स्थापना शामिल होती है। |
दोष सहनशीलता के परिप्रेक्ष्य और भविष्य की प्रौद्योगिकियाँ
जैसे-जैसे प्रौद्योगिकी आगे बढ़ती है, दोष सहनशीलता अधिक परिष्कृत और अनुकूली होने की उम्मीद है। कुछ संभावित भविष्य की प्रौद्योगिकियों में शामिल हैं:
-
यंत्र अधिगम: संभावित विफलताओं की भविष्यवाणी करने और उन्हें सक्रिय रूप से कम करने के लिए मशीन लर्निंग एल्गोरिदम को लागू करना।
-
स्वायत्त पुनर्प्राप्ति: स्व-उपचार प्रणालियाँ विकसित करना जो मानवीय हस्तक्षेप के बिना विफलताओं से स्वचालित रूप से उबर सकती हैं।
-
क्वांटम दोष सहनशीलता: क्वांटम सूचना त्रुटियों को संभालने के लिए क्वांटम कंप्यूटरों के लिए दोष-सहिष्णु तकनीकों की खोज।
-
एज कंप्यूटिंग: नेटवर्क के किनारे पर प्रोसेसिंग की विश्वसनीयता बढ़ाने के लिए एज कंप्यूटिंग सिस्टम में दोष सहनशीलता लागू करना।
प्रॉक्सी सर्वर फ़ॉल्ट टॉलरेंस से कैसे जुड़े हैं
OneProxy जैसे प्रॉक्सी सर्वर प्रदाता के लिए, प्रॉक्सी सेवाओं तक निर्बाध पहुंच सुनिश्चित करने के लिए दोष सहिष्णुता आवश्यक है। उनके बुनियादी ढांचे में दोष सहिष्णुता को लागू करने से हार्डवेयर विफलता या नेटवर्क व्यवधान की स्थिति में भी उपयोगकर्ताओं के लिए विश्वसनीय प्रॉक्सी कनेक्शन बनाए रखने में मदद मिलती है। अतिरेक, लोड संतुलन और फेलओवर तंत्र को नियोजित करके, OneProxy अपने ग्राहकों को एक मजबूत और भरोसेमंद प्रॉक्सी सेवा प्रदान कर सकता है।
सम्बंधित लिंक्स
दोष सहनशीलता के बारे में अधिक जानकारी के लिए, आप निम्नलिखित संसाधनों पर जा सकते हैं:
निष्कर्ष
कंप्यूटर सिस्टम और नेटवर्क की विश्वसनीयता और उपलब्धता सुनिश्चित करने में दोष सहिष्णुता महत्वपूर्ण भूमिका निभाती है। OneProxy जैसे प्रॉक्सी सर्वर प्रदाता के लिए, अपने ग्राहकों को निर्बाध और निर्बाध प्रॉक्सी सेवाएं प्रदान करने के लिए दोष सहनशीलता महत्वपूर्ण है। अतिरेक, त्रुटि का पता लगाने और विफलता तंत्र को लागू करके, OneProxy उच्च स्तर की गलती सहनशीलता बनाए रख सकता है और एक विश्वसनीय और मजबूत प्रॉक्सी सेवा प्रदान कर सकता है। जैसे-जैसे प्रौद्योगिकी आगे बढ़ती है, दोष सहनशीलता और विकसित होने की उम्मीद है, जिससे भविष्य में और भी अधिक लचीली और अनुकूली प्रणालियों का मार्ग प्रशस्त होगा।